CVE-2026-86153
A vulnerability has been found in Tenda CP3 27.5.57.101. This affects the function CRedirServer::SetRedirectEnable of the file Functions/Redirect.cpp. The manipulation leads to improper privilege management. Remote exploitation of the attack is possible.
